B Finds His Passion

B has long wanted to become a farmer. B has a one track mind. So, Mom decided to humor him by taking him to the 4H open house at the fairgrounds today. She was pretty sure he'd see how lame it all was and decide to ditch out.
Emmit met us there and together they visited booths on cows, rabbits, sewing, canning, planting, building, sheep, horses and goats. Here they are with a little chicken.

and the pony

Unfortunately, you can see by the smile on his face, that Mom's plan was a huge failure. So, they trudged on over to the sign up table where a lil old farm lady asked B "So... you're interested in signing up for 4H sweetheart?"
In typical B fashion, he avoided eye contact and gave an ever so slight nod.
Not to be deterred, the sweet little old lady asked: "What are you interested in darling?"
B: "Goats."
Sweet Little Innocent Lady: "Oh! Goats are neat! What would you like to learn about them?"
B: "Fighting. I wanna do Goat Fighting."

If we could capture the look on that sweet little old farm lady's horrified face, I don't know that we could put it here as this is a family blog. Let's just say she was shocked!
But who are we to deny the kid his passion? Mom soon found a clever t-shirt and we are all anxiously awaiting the debut of Goat Fighting at the Indiana State Fair this summer :)
